Mr. & Mrs. Wedding Card

August 29, 2008 By: admin Category: Cards

Here’s a wedding card I made back in July for my friend, Julie. I used the All In The Family stamp set with Basic Grey Blush PP. I cut out and embossed the square scallops with my Nestabilities dies, although the embossing is hard to see in the photo.

Julie wore red shoes with her wedding dress so I colored the shoes of the bride red. My favorite part of the card is the Dazzling Diamonds. I used Dazzling Diamonds on the dress and also on the strip across the card. I adhered double sided sticky tape and sprinkled the glitter over it.

The “Mr. & Mrs.” sentiment is from the Fundamental Phrases stamp set.

Decor Elements

August 22, 2008 By: admin Category: Projects

I was really excited when Stampin’ Up announced their newest product line of vinyl wall rubons, Decor Elements. The rubons come in select variety of Stampin’ Up images and you can put them on your walls and all around your house. They are really easy to apply. You can peel them off the wall to remove and they don’t leave stains. The only thing is that they have a one time usage, so when you remove it, you can’t use it again.

As a reminder to all of the things I have to be grateful for everyday, I got the “Life Is Good” image. I put it on a blank area above my staircase so every time I go down the stairs, I am reminded that life is good!

Anyways, here’s a card I made with one of the new stamp sets from the new Fall-Winter Collection CatalogDreams Du Jour. I made this card for my downline, Stephanie, who turned 30 earlier this month.

I use the new In Colors for this one (Pink Pirouette, Riding Hood Red, and Kiwi Kiss) and the new Bella Rose Designer Series Paper. The numbers “30″ are American Crafts Thickers. I used Prisma Color pencils to color in the stamp and stamped the butterflies, trimmed them out, and adhered them with Stampin’ Dimensionals. I wasn’t immediately attracted to the new In Colors or Bella Rose look, but I definitely have to say they grew on me and I now love both!

Notecard Holder Tutorial

June 09, 2008 By: admin Category: Projects, Tutorials

Ok, I finally finished the notecard holder tutorial! Thanks everyone for being so patient! I made this notecard holder just for the sake of this tutorial and to show the measurements, so it isn’t the fanciest.

Step 1: Cut & Score the following pieces of cardstock:

7 1/2″ x 7 1/2″ - score 1 1/2″ in on 3 of 4 sides

7 1/2″ x 6 1/2″ - score 1″ in on the 6 1/2″ side and 1 1/2″ in on one 7 1/2″ side


8 9/16″ x 5 9/16″ - score 2″ in on every side (this is the lid)

Step 2: Create the flaps by cutting like this.

Step 3: Before you assemble, adhere your decorative piece of patterned paper to the front and back if you wish. The DS paper should measure 4 1/4″ x 5 3/4″.

Step 4: Apply adhesive to the box and assemble.
